What Is Full-Arch Replacement?
Full-arch replacement is a dental procedure developed to bring back an entire arc of missing out on teeth, usually in the upper or lower jaw. This process includes making use of dental implants or a repaired prosthesis, which can substantially improve your dental function and aesthetic look.
If you're missing most or every one of your teeth, this choice could be optimal for you, as it gives a steady and durable option.
Throughout the procedure, your dental professional will certainly evaluate your jawbone's wellness and framework. If necessary, they'll do bone implanting to guarantee there suffices support for the implants.
Hereafter, they'll position the implants into the jawbone, functioning as roots for your new teeth. You'll after that await the implants to incorporate with the bone, a process known as osseointegration, which can take numerous months.
When recovery is total, your dental professional will certainly connect the personalized prosthetic teeth to the implants. This method not only restores your smile yet likewise helps keep your jawbone's integrity.
Inevitably, full-arch replacement uses an extensive solution for those dealing with considerable missing teeth, providing both useful and esthetic advantages.

Risks of Full-Arch Replacement
While the benefits of full-arch replacements are engaging, it is necessary to evaluate the threats that feature the procedure. One substantial threat is the possibility for infection. After surgery, there's always a possibility that bacteria could get in the surgical website, resulting in complications.
You may additionally experience blood loss, which, while typically convenient, can often call for more intervention.
An additional problem is nerve damage. During the treatment, close-by nerves can be impacted, resulting in feeling numb or discomfort. This may fix gradually, yet in some cases, it can bring about long-lasting issues.
Additionally, you may deal with problems connected to the implants themselves. These can include helping to loosen, crack, or failing of the prosthetic, requiring added surgical procedures.
Lastly, don't neglect the possibility of an unfavorable aesthetic outcome. Your new arc may not meet your expectations, leading to frustration and the need for changes.
It's essential to go over these risks completely with your oral expert to ensure you're making a notified choice. Recognizing these prospective disadvantages will certainly aid you weigh them against the benefits and establish if a full-arch substitute is right for you.
